How to Install Akruti Software in Windows 11 Akruti is a widely used multilingual Indian language typing software. It allows users to easily type in regional scripts such as Odia, Hindi, Bengali, Telugu, and Marathi.

Installing older versions like Akruti 7.0 on modern operating systems like Windows 11 requires specific steps to ensure complete compatibility with Microsoft Office, Adobe Photoshop, and CorelDRAW. Prerequisites for Windows 11 Installation how to install akruti software in windows 11

To prevent installation errors, ensure the system meets these basic requirements before starting: OS Version: Windows 11 (Home, Pro, or Enterprise). Architecture: 64-bit. Permissions: Administrator access is mandatory.

Antivirus Software: Temporarily pause your antivirus or Windows Defender to prevent font installation blocks. Step-by-Step Installation Guide

Follow these steps to download, extract, and install Akruti correctly on Windows 11. 1. Download the Installer

Obtain the installation files from the official Akruti Products Page or an authorized distributor like Satya IT Solution. Save the compressed ZIP file to your Downloads folder. 2. Extract the ZIP Files Open the file manager and find the downloaded ZIP file. Right-click the file and select Extract All. Choose a destination folder and click Extract. 3. Run the Installation Setup Open the extracted folder and find Setup.exe. Right-click Setup.exe and select Run as administrator. Click Yes on the User Account Control (UAC) prompt. 4. Navigate the Setup Wizard Welcome Screen: Click Next to begin the process.

User Information: Enter your Name and Organization, then click Next.

Destination Folder: Use the default installation directory C:\Program Files (x86)\Akruti and click Next.

Setup Type: Choose Full to install all fonts and layout drivers.

Install: Click Next, review the installation summary, and select Install.

Finish: Once complete, click Finish and restart your computer if prompted. Configuration & Usage on Windows 11

To start typing in your preferred language, configure the language settings within the software dashboard.

Launch the App: Double-click the Akruti icon on your desktop.

Select Language: Click the software dashboard to choose your typing script (e.g., Odia Mode, Hindi Mode).

Switch Keyboards: Use the designated shortcut keys provided in your version's readme file to toggle between English and regional inputs.

Verify in Apps: Open Microsoft Word, change the active font to an Akruti font (e.g., AkrutiDev), and start typing. Troubleshooting Common Windows 11 Errors 1. Keyboards or Letters Not Typing Correctly

Modern Office packages may conflict with legacy software hooks.

Fix: Right-click the Akruti shortcut on your desktop, go to Properties > Compatibility, check Run this program in compatibility mode for Windows 7/10, and check Run as administrator. Apply and restart the application. 2. Missing Fonts in Microsoft Word or Photoshop

Fix: Navigate to the folder where Akruti was installed. Locate the .ttf font files, select all of them, right-click, and select Install for all users. 3. Setup Blocked by Windows SmartScreen

and wait for the process to finish. Once done, it is highly recommended to restart your computer to properly load the new fonts into the Windows font cache. How to Use Akruti in Windows 11 Start the Engine

: Open the Akruti Engine application from your desktop or Start menu. Select Layout

: Choose your preferred keyboard layout (e.g., Phonetic or Inscript) from the Toggle Typing : Press the Scroll Lock

key to turn the engine on or off. When Scroll Lock is active, you can type in your selected Indian language in applications like Microsoft Word or Excel. Select Fonts

: In your application (e.g., MS Word), choose a font that starts with "Akruti" (e.g., AkrutiOri_B ) to ensure the characters display correctly. Microsoft Learn Common Troubleshooting Tips
